How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your urgent call to San Bernardino Damage Experts initiates rapid deployment. We gather crucial details about the water intrusion to dispatch the right team immediately. Our 24/7 service is ready.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our IICRC-certified technicians use moisture meters and thermal imaging to precisely locate all water damage. This comprehensive assessment guides our restoration strategy, ensuring no hidden moisture remains.
3
Water Extraction
Powerful industrial extractors remove standing water quickly. This critical step prevents further saturation and reduces drying time, preparing the area for thorough dehumidification and sanitization.
4
Drying & Dehumidification
High-velocity air movers and commercial dehumidifiers dry affected structures and contents. We monitor humidity levels daily, preventing mold growth and preserving your property's integrity.
5
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Contaminated areas are thoroughly cleaned, disinfected, and deodorized using EPA-approved solutions. This eliminates bacteria and odors, ensuring a safe and healthy environment for you.
6
Final Inspection
A meticulous final inspection confirms complete dryness and restoration. We walk you through the restored areas, ensuring your satisfaction with our work. Your property is ready.

Warning Signs You Need Structural Drying Services

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. Keep an eye out for these common red flags:

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Unpleasant odors can show hidden moisture and mold growth. If you notice persistent musty smells, it's time to call us in.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

If your flooring is warping or buckling, it's a sign of excess moisture. Don't ignore this issue, it can lead to costly repairs down the line.

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ls

Water stains can show a leak or water damage. Addressing this issue quickly can prevent further damage and safety hazards.

Visible Mold or Mildew

Mold and mildew growth can lead to serious health issues. If you notice visible growth, it's time to call us in for a thorough inspection and removal.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ks can show structural damage or settling. Don't 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s if left untreated.

Water-Saturated Insulation or Drywall

Water-saturated insulation or drywall can lead to serious safety hazards and costly repairs. If you notice this issue, call us in immediately.

Structural Drying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ill in a contained area Yes No You can likely handle it on your own with a mop and towels.
Water damage in a large area or with multiple levels No Yes Complexity and safety hazards need professional expertise.
Vis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Professional removal and prevention are necessary to prevent health issues.
Water-saturated insulation or drywall No Yes Structural damage and safety hazards need immediate attention from a professional.
Insurance claim for water damage No Yes Professional help ensures a smooth claims process and best insurance coverage.
Preventive maintenance to avoid future issues Yes Yes Regular inspections and maintenance can help prevent costly repairs and safety hazards.

Common Questions About Structural Drying Services

How long will it take to dry my property?

The drying process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the issue and the effectiveness of our equipment. Our technicians will monitor the area closely to ensure the drying process is complete and effective.

Will I need to move out of my home during the drying process?

In most cases, you can stay in your home during the drying process. But, in severe cases, it may be necessary to vacate the premises temporarily. Our technicians will work with you to find out the best course of action.

Can I handle the drying process myself?

While some small water spills can be handled on your own, large-scale water damage or structural issues need professional expertise. Our team has the training, equipment, and experience to ensure a safe and effective drying process.
